Those fabulous Hungarians

November 16, 2011 at 4:53 PM

Here is the fabulous Illenyi family playing an arrangement of Paganini Caprice No. 24. Ferenc, the first man that you see, is a violinist in the Houston Symphony. His sister Katica seems to be quite popular in Hungary. Check out her other videos.
